Factors Affecting Door Handle Fixing Costs
The cost of fixing or replacing a door handle can vary considerably based upon several aspects. Below are some crucial elements that can affect the general expense:
FactorDescriptionType of HandleVarious types of door handles (e.g., lever, knob, electronic) come with varying rate points.ProductHandles made from resilient materials such as stainless steel or brass might cost more than plastic handles.Labor CostsWorking with a professional for installation or repair can contribute to the general cost, especially in urban areas.Additional RepairsIf the door itself is harmed or requires changes, this will increase the overall costs.LocationGeographical place can play a significant function in rates, with city locations usually being more costly.Brand namePremium brand names may charge more for their door handles compared to less-known brands.Kinds Of Door Handles and Their Average Costs
Door handles come in different designs, each with its own cost considerations. Here's a breakdown of common types of door handle repair and installation handles, along with their average costs:
Type of HandleAverage CostDescriptionStandard Knob₤ 10 - ₤ 30Basic and commonly used in residential homes; simple to set up.Lever Handle₤ 20 - ₤ 50Uses better grip and is more available, particularly for those with specials needs.Mortise Handle₤ 40 - ₤ 100Requires a mortise cut in the door; often used in industrial settings.Electronic Handle₤ 100 - ₤ 300Features keyless entry; may feature Bluetooth or Wi-Fi abilities.Pull Handle₤ 20 - ₤ 150Typically used for sliding doors; can be found in numerous styles and materials.Gate Handle₤ 10 - ₤ 50Utilized for outside gates; varies widely based on product and style.Labor Costs for Installation
If you choose professional assistance to install or repair your door handles, labor expenses need to be thought about. Here's a basic idea of what to expect:
ServiceTypical Labor CostBasic Installation₤ 50 - ₤ 100Repairing Existing Handles₤ 30 - ₤ 75Changing Locks with Handles₤ 75 - ₤ 150Breakdown of Total Costs
When considering the overall cost for fixing or changing door handles, the last cost can differ widely. Here's a summarized breakdown of possible expenses based upon typical situations:
ScenarioEstimated Total CostDo it yourself Installation of a Standard Knob₤ 10 - ₤ 30Professional Installation of Lever Handle₤ 70 - ₤ 150 (including labor)Repairing a Mortise Handle₤ 40 - ₤ 200Upgrading to an Electronic Handle₤ 100 - ₤ 400 (including labor)DIY vs. Professional Help

How frequently should door handles be changed?
door handle locksmith handles can last several years, but they ought to be examined routinely for indications of wear. If you see difficulties in operation, excessive wobbling, or noticeable damage, it might be time for a replacement.
2. Can I fix a loose door handle myself?
Yes, most of the times, a loose door handle can be tightened with a screwdriver. If the handle continues to loosen, it might require replacement.
3. What tools do I need for DIY door handle installation?
Typical tools consist of a screwdriver, drill (if required), measuring tape, and possibly a sculpt for mortise handles.
4. Are electronic door handles worth the investment?
They provide included security and benefit, especially for businesses or tech-savvy homeowners. However, think about the continuous costs of batteries and possible repairs.
5. How can I select the right door handle for my home?
Think about the design, functionality, and product. Guarantee it matches your home design and meets your ease of access requires.
